What is NDC 81763-001?

The NDC code 81763-001 is assigned by the FDA to the product Penacom Hypochlorous Acid Disinfectant which is product labeled by Shenzhen Qianhai Penaclo Biotechnology Co., Ltd. The product's dosage form is . The product is distributed in a single package with assigned NDC code 81763-001-01 100 ml in 1 box . Product Footnotes

[5] What is the Labeler Name? - Name of Company corresponding to the labeler code segment of the Product NDC.

[9] What is the Start Marketing Date? - This is the date that the labeler indicates was the start of its marketing of the drug product.

[11] What is the Listing Expiration Date? - This is the date when the listing record will expire if not updated or certified by the product labeler.

[12] What is the NDC Exclude Flag? - This field indicates whether the product has been removed/excluded from the NDC Directory for failure to respond to FDA"s requests for correction to deficient or non-compliant submissions ("Y"), or because the listing certification is expired ("E"), or because the listing data was inactivated by FDA ("I"). Values = "Y", "N", "E", or "I".
